From 5396c61971e04ad8a5d8f09a4f7967d71b6eb940 Mon Sep 17 00:00:00 2001 From: Alois Mahdal Date: Feb 20 2019 21:51:19 +0000 Subject: Don't leak when matching on string assert --- diff --git a/src/preupg.sh.skel b/src/preupg.sh.skel index dfc67b3..b7ff07a 100644 --- a/src/preupg.sh.skel +++ b/src/preupg.sh.skel @@ -902,7 +902,7 @@ __preupg__assert1() { esac case $Type in int) jat__eval -S $es -h "$hint" "test $(eval "$code") -eq $Value" ;; - str) jat__eval -S $es -h "$hint" "$code | grep -e '$Value'" ;; + str) jat__eval -S $es -h "$hint" "$code | grep -qe '$Value'" ;; esac }